What does snazzy mean?

Looking for the meaning or definition of the word snazzy? Here's what it means.

Adjective
  1. (informal) Elegant in manner of dress; stylish, modern or appealing in appearance; flashy.
  2. (informal) Excellent; clever, ingenious, or adept in behavior, operation, or execution.

Examples
Over 300 organizations and businesses set up snazzy booths to sell wares, distribute information and collect signatures for various petitions.
This snazzy function will appeal to anyone who has ever dug for a key in the rain while holding seven carrier bags of shopping.
In fifth grade, I had a snazzy red electric guitar with a whammy bar that I never really learned how to play.
He created a snazzy facade of silver squares with rounded corners that create sharply pointed stars at their junctures.
Aside from a few snazzy Tupperware lines, most storage containers are ugly.
A few inexpensive pots of snazzy red tulips, golden daffodils or purple crocus can brighten a dreary spring day.
